Output ecfb1b579a8d6db2af918ac88ddb7bb9a943e4d7e43969985381f52091a5253a:0

value
2089388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e5ff336e4f6106976803ce8e127dbe4907e593 OP_EQUAL
address
34sYRXehTRrtNN45JgJ47dUoiZmjShoCw9
transaction
ecfb1b579a8d6db2af918ac88ddb7bb9a943e4d7e43969985381f52091a5253a
spent
true